This home in brief

53 Leahurst Crescent, in B17, is a leasehold flat / maisonette on Leahurst Crescent. It last sold for £151,000 in 2021 — its 2nd recorded sale, up 56% on its first recorded sale of £97,000 in 2013. For context, B17's median over the last 8 years is £312,250 — this home's last sale was 52% lower.
